51 lines
692 B
Plaintext
51 lines
692 B
Plaintext
|
MAJORCOMP=ntos
|
||
|
MINORCOMP=dd
|
||
|
|
||
|
TARGETNAME=GrClass
|
||
|
TARGETTYPE=DRIVER
|
||
|
DRIVERTYPE=WDM
|
||
|
TARGETPATH=obj
|
||
|
|
||
|
|
||
|
TARGETLIBS=$(DDK_LIB_PATH)\smclib.lib \
|
||
|
$(DDK_LIB_PATH)\usbd.lib
|
||
|
|
||
|
|
||
|
# add compilation definition
|
||
|
C_DEFINES=-DWDM_KERNEL -DUSB_DEVICE -DUSBREADER_PROJECT
|
||
|
|
||
|
INCLUDES=..\inc;
|
||
|
|
||
|
USE_MAPSYM = 1
|
||
|
|
||
|
MSC_WARNING_LEVEL= /W3 /WX
|
||
|
|
||
|
|
||
|
SOURCES=grclass.rc \
|
||
|
gemlog.mc \
|
||
|
driver.cpp\
|
||
|
gemcore.cpp \
|
||
|
kernel.cpp \
|
||
|
LVprot.cpp \
|
||
|
\
|
||
|
usbdev.cpp \
|
||
|
usbreader.cpp \
|
||
|
\
|
||
|
interface.cpp \
|
||
|
iopack.cpp \
|
||
|
protocol.cpp \
|
||
|
smartcard.cpp \
|
||
|
thread.cpp \
|
||
|
\
|
||
|
wdmdebug.cpp \
|
||
|
wdmevent.cpp \
|
||
|
wdmint.cpp \
|
||
|
wdmirp.cpp \
|
||
|
wdmlock.cpp \
|
||
|
wdmlog.cpp \
|
||
|
wdmmem.cpp \
|
||
|
wdmpower.cpp \
|
||
|
wdmsem.cpp \
|
||
|
wdmsys.cpp \
|
||
|
wdmtimer.cpp
|